6517 SW 85th St, Ocala, FL 34476-9009

POSSIBLE RESIDENT(S):
OCALA STATS:
Total population 58,598
Males
28,800
Females
29,798
Median Household Income $40,301
Source: U.S. Census Bureau, 2018
NEARBY ADDRESSES IN 34476:
5866 SW 117th Lane Rd, Ocala, FL 34476
7615 SW 79th St, Ocala, FL 34476
7233 SW 111th Ln, Ocala, FL 34476
10131 SW 61st Terrace Rd, Ocala, FL 34476
11270 SW 75th Ave, Ocala, FL 34476